About

Gaoming Liu is a scholar working on Molecular Biology, Oncology and Surgery. According to data from OpenAlex, Gaoming Liu has authored 35 papers receiving a total of 284 ind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 9 papers in Molecular Biology, 6 papers in Oncology and 5 papers in Surgery. Recurrent topics in Gaoming Liu's work include Health Sciences Research and Education (4 papers), Genomics and Phylogenetic Studies (3 papers) and Epigenetics and DNA Methylation (3 papers). Gaoming Liu is often cited by papers focused on Health Sciences Research and Education (4 papers), Genomics and Phylogenetic Studies (3 papers) and Epigenetics and DNA Methylation (3 papers). Gaoming Liu collaborates with scholars based in China, United States and Finland. Gaoming Liu's co-authors include Xiong Peng, Silvia Dorn, Maohua Chen, Yan Zheng, Shipeng Yan, Yao Tang, Shuang Hu, Jina Li, Maritta Välimäki and Xuming Zhou and has published in prestigious journals such as Nature Communications, The EMBO Journal and PLoS ONE.
